The human face is the most anterior portion of the human head. it refers to the area that extends from the superior margin of the forehead to the chin, and from one ear to another. the basic shape of the human face is determined by the underlying facial skeleton (i.e. viscerocranium), the facial muscles and the amount of subcutaneous tissue.
